Notes and ideas from meeting on 15 Dec 2023 with Stephan Preibisch, Konrad Rokicki, and John Bogovic. | ||
|
||
## Array Data | ||
|
||
Array data MUST be stored as OME-Zarr and MAY contain channels and time axes. | ||
|
||
* If channels are stored in zarr arrays, then every array MUST: | ||
* contain the same number of channels | ||
* contain channels in the same order | ||
|
||
* If time are stored in zarr arrays, then every array MUST: | ||
* contain the same number of time points | ||
* contain times in the same order | ||
|
||
## Metadata | ||
|
||
The top level zarr group contains metadata that describes | ||
|
||
* What attributes are present in the zarr store | ||
* Whether attributes are stored in the directory hierarchy as a group or | ||
as part of a zarr array | ||
|
||
### Axes | ||
|
||
Axes metadata (inherited from OME-Zarr) enumerate all the attributes in | ||
the hierarchy and image axes, and describes whether they are stored as | ||
part of the hierarchy of groups or as part of an array, and orders those | ||
attributes in the hierarchy. | ||
|
||
We add a `storage` field to objects in the `axes` array that may take | ||
one of two values `"group"` or `"array"` which indicate that the axis or | ||
attribute is stored as part of the group hierarchy or as part of an | ||
array, respectively. | ||
|
||
Axes with `type: space` MUST also have `storage: array`. | ||
|
||
For example: | ||
|
||
```json | ||
{ "axes": [ | ||
{ "name": "i", "type": "tile", "storage": "group" }, | ||
{ "name": "a", "type": "angle", "storage": "group" }, | ||
{ "name": "c", "type": "channel", "storage": "array" }, | ||
{ "name": "t", "type": "time", "storage": "array" }, | ||
{ "name": "z", "type": "space", "storage": "array" }, | ||
{ "name": "y", "type": "space", "storage": "array" }, | ||
{ "name": "x", "type": "space", "storage": "array" } | ||
]} | ||
``` | ||
|
||

### Attribute hierarchy | ||
|
||
The `hierarchy` metadata describes the child groups that are present / | ||
missing. | ||
|
||
The `attributes` metadata stores a an array of objects. | ||
|
||
Each object MUST: | ||
|
||
* contain the field `name` that MUST correspond to the `name` of one of the `axes`. | ||
* contain the field `objects` whose value MUST be an array. The array | ||
MAY be empty | ||
|
||
Each entry in the `objects` array MUST be an object and MUST: | ||
|
||
* contain the field `id` whose value MUST be a string | ||
* contain the field `metadata` whose value MUST be an object | ||
|
||
The `missing` metadata stores an array of objects that encode elements | ||
of the hierarchy that may not exist. | ||
|
||
|
||
```json | ||

"attributes": [ | ||
{ | ||
"name": "i", | ||
"type": "tile", | ||
"objects": [ | ||
{ | ||
"id": "0", | ||
"metadata": { "tile metadata": {} } | ||
}, | ||
{ | ||
"id": "1", | ||
"metadata": { "tile metadata": {} } | ||
} | ||
] | ||
}, | ||
{ | ||
"name": "a", | ||
"type": "angle", | ||
"objects": [ | ||
{ | ||
"id": "00", | ||
"metadata": { "angle metadata": "foo" } | ||
}, | ||
{ | ||
"id": "01", | ||
"metadata": { "angle metadata": "bar" } | ||
} | ||
] | ||
} | ||
], | ||
"missing" : [ | ||
{ "tile": "1", "angle": "00" } | ||
] | ||
} | ||
``` | ||
|
||
Every combination of attribute name MUST be present in the hierarchy | ||
except those attribute-ids listed in the `missing` array. | ||
|
||
In this example, the hierarchy could look like this: | ||
|
||
``` | ||
root.zarr | ||
│ | ||
├── i0 | ||
│ ├── a00 | ||
│ └── a01 | ||
│ | ||
└── i1 | ||
└── a01 | ||
|
||
``` | ||
